Haiti to get Best Western business hotel

Best Western International plans to open a business hotel in Haiti late this summer.

The 105-room, seven-story hotel will be located in Petion-Ville, a hillside city southeast of the capital of Port-au-Prince.

The opening will mark the Caribbean debut of Best Western’s Premier, an upscale sub-brand.

Facilities will include a restaurant and lounge, banquet space, a pool and a spa.

Best Western is not the only hotel company coming to Haiti. Marriott International plans to open a 173-room hotel in Port-au-Prince in 2014.

Choice Hotels' plans to open two properties in Haiti -- first announced in January 2010 just days before a deadly earthquake -- remain on the table, although the timeline is unclear.
